- who: Georgina Pettinari and colleagues from the Universitu00e9 catholique de Louvain, (RAS), Russia Nicolaus Copernicus University in have published the research work: Autophagy modulates growth and development in the moss Physcomitrium patens, in the Journal: (JOURNAL)
- what: Altogether this study provides valuable information about autophagy roles during apical growth highlighting a degree of cell-type specificity in the autophagy response within the same tissue, which in turn affects the progression of the 2D and 3D tissues of P. patens.
